EPA Floats Options To Curb CWA 404 ‘Veto’ But Stops Short Of Pruitt Calls

September 4, 2019
EPA is seeking comment from state and local governments on possible changes to its rules that in some cases could limit how and when the agency objects to Clean Water Act (CWA) section 404 dredge-and-fill permits issued by the Army Corps of Engineers, though the options stop short of calls from former Administrator Scott Pruitt who sought to eliminate the authority.
